Am I allowed to bring butterfly feeders into the conservatory?
No, butterfly feeders are NOT allowed into the conservatory. We have feeders and food available to our butterflies at all times and closely monitor their health. You are welcome to purchase a feeder from our gift shop to enjoy at home.
I’d like to do a butterfly release at home. Can I purchase a kit from you?
Yes, you can purchase butterflies for release for $5-$10ea (price varies based on species) or 12 butterflies for $55-$100 (based on species). We safely package the butterflies for release at your home, wedding, memorial, or celebration of life events.
We also sell caterpillars, chrysalis, cocoons, and praying mantids in our gift shop and online store. You are welcome to hatch the caterpillars at home and release the butterflies in the conservatory for free. Butterflies that hatch between October-April will not survive the cold temperatures outside. You can bring your butterfly in their temporary home to Magic Wings and release it inside the Conservatory.

Are strollers allowed?
Strollers are allowed in our Atrium, gift shop, Pollinator Playroom, and outdoor gardens. Due to USDA regulations, strollers are NOT allowed inside the conservatory.
Wheelchairs, walkers, rollators, and certified service dogs wearing their service vests are allowed in the conservatory.
How many butterflies can I expect to see there?
We have over 4,000 free-flying butterflies in the Conservatory, along with button quails, a Senegal Parrot, chameleon, and other reptiles, tortoises and koi.
What other critters will I see at Magic Wings?
In our Wonderarium, you will see dart frogs, Madagascar hissing cockroaches, Vietnamese Mossy frogs, and stick bugs. Make sure you visit Porkchop, our Columbian Tegu, before you head into the Conservatory!
In addition to being home to over 4,000 butterflies, our Conservatory is also home to Randolph, our Russian Tortoise, Sassy and Humphrina, our Red Footed Tortoises, button quail, reptiles, and koi fish. Our parrot, Akbar, also lives in the Conservatory.
